Shear-Induced Phase Separation in Polymer Solutions

Abstract
We examine spinodal decomposition induced in sheared semidilute polymer solutions which were stable in quiescent states. We find a transverse elastic force acting on polymers. It causes a diffusive flux of polymers from lower to higher concentration regions in mechanical equilibrium. This mechanism can also explain formation of a slipping layer in capillary flows. The scattering amplidue is also calculated in weak shear.
